Emotional Support and Unconditional Love

Pets provide emotional support that can significantly improve our overall mental health. The bond between a pet and its owner is often characterized by unconditional love and affection. This connection can help alleviate feelings of loneliness and anxiety. For many, the simple act of petting a dog or cat can trigger the release of oxytocin, a hormone associated with bonding and emotional wellbeing, creating feelings of happiness and security.

Reducing Stress and Anxiety

Interacting with pets has been shown to reduce stress levels and promote relaxation. Studies indicate that spending time with animals can lower blood pressure and cortisol levels, which are often elevated during stressful situations. The presence of a pet can create a calming effect, allowing individuals to feel more at ease in their environment.

Encouraging Physical Activity

Having a household pet, especially a dog, encourages physical activity. Regular walks, playtime, and active engagement with pets can lead to improved physical health, which is closely linked to mental health. Exercise releases endorphins, the body’s natural mood lifters, and can help combat feelings of depression and anxiety.

Social Interaction and Community Building

Pets can also serve as a bridge to social interaction. Dog owners, for instance, often meet and connect with other pet owners during walks or at dog parks. This socialization can help reduce feelings of isolation and foster a sense of community. Being part of a pet-related community can provide emotional support and friendship, further enhancing mental well-being.

Routine and Structure

Owning a pet requires a certain level of routine and responsibility, which can be beneficial for mental health. Establishing a daily schedule for feeding, walking, and caring for a pet can provide a sense of purpose and stability. This structure can be particularly helpful for individuals struggling with depression or anxiety, as it encourages them to engage in daily activities and maintain a healthy routine.

Therapeutic Benefits of Animal Companionship

Animal-assisted therapy has gained recognition as an effective treatment for various mental health issues. Trained therapy animals can help individuals with conditions such as PTSD, depression, and anxiety. The presence of a therapy animal can create a safe space for individuals to express their feelings and work through their challenges. This therapeutic connection can accelerate healing and promote emotional growth.

Boosting Self-Esteem and Confidence

Caring for a pet can significantly boost self-esteem and confidence. The responsibility of looking after an animal and seeing them thrive can foster a sense of accomplishment. This is especially important for individuals who may struggle with self-worth or have faced challenges in their lives. Pets can remind us of our capabilities and the positive impact we can have on others.
